Join Citi's Equities team as a Low-Latency Java Data Systems Engineer. Play a pivotal role in constructing and managing our data resources for electronic trading systems.
This position targets engineers with 7+ years of experience in low-latency Java, C++, or Rust, tasked with building essential data infrastructures. Your work will involve developing systems that ensure event transport and accurate market data processing while adhering to stringent performance standards. Collaborate with teams globally, influencing our technical framework and operational protocols.
Key Responsibilities: • Design and construct Java data pipelines with strict guarantees • Build systems with high throughput and low contention methods • Develop effective data distribution recovery strategies • Work with real-time event handling and state management • Contribute to performance-focused testing frameworks
Requirements: • Minimum 7 years in a low-latency setting • Proficient in data ...